European Athletics Results 2015 (1)

BELGIUM
Gent (Belgium), 3.1.2015
–Vlaams Brabant Kampioenschappen- (indoor)

Men
400m Tim Rummens 48.75; SP Remco Goetheer (ned) 17.18
Women
800m u20 Renee Eykens 2.10.52; 60mh Dorien Van Diest 8.73; PV Elien De Vocht 4.01
Gent (Belgium), 4.1.2015 –West Vlaanderen/Oost Vlaanderen Kampioenschappen- (indoor)
Women
60m 1 Esther Van der Hende 7.54; 2 Yasmine Gharafi 7.67; 200m Nenah De Coninck 24.55; 60mh 1
Neneha De Coninck 8.55; 2 Justien Grillet 8.71

DENMARK
Arhus (Denmark), 29.12.2014
–Sidste Chancen 2014- (indoor)

Men
50mh Andreas Martinsen 6.86; 60mh Andreas Martinsen 8.07; HJ Jonas Klogjard Jensen (96) 2.11; SP
u18 (5 kg) Marcus Thomsen 17.80
Women
50m Sara Petersen 6.75; 60m Sara Petersen 7.62; 60mh 1 Marie Caroline Vermund 8.65; 2 Mette
Graversgaard 8.77

ESTONIA

Tallinn (Estonia), 2.1.2015 (indoor)

Men
60mh u19 (0,91m) Hans-Christian Hausenberg 8.14; PV Mareks Arents (lat) 5.10; PV u18 Sander
Moldau 4.75; SP u20 (6 kg) Artjom Nikitin 16.98
Women
150m Maarja Kalev 18.54; 150m u20 Kreete Verlin 18.79; PV u18 Margit Kalk (99) 3.90
Tallinn (Estonia), 3.1.2015 (indoor)
Men
LJ 1 Rain Kask 7.61; 2 Henrik Kutberg 7.58; 3 Mihkel Saks 7.52; 4 Hans-Christian Hausenberg (98) 7.33

FRANCE
Aubière (France), 3.1.2015 (indoor)
–Meeting des Volcans-

Men
60m A 1 Raihau Maiau 6.82; 2 Mustapha Traore 6.91; 60m B Adrien Ferrer 6.96; 60m F Stephane
Gauthier 6.96; 60m second round 1 Rahiau Maiau 6.77; 2 Adrien Ferrer 6.92; 3 Mustapha Traore 6.93;
400m heat 1 Thibaut Dambricourt 47.94; 2 Jacques François 48.65; 400m heat 2 Adrien Coulibaly (96)
48.75, TJ 1 Jonathan Drack (mri) 16.22; 2 Jean-Marc Pontvianne 15.98; 3 Ulrick Bolosier 15.95
Women
60m A 1 Maroussia Pare (96) 7.52; 2 Nasrane Bacar 7.59; 3 Olivia Mazeau 7.70; 4 Elea Mariama Diarra
7.75; 60m B Helene Parisot 7.65; 60m secon round A 1 Nasrane Bacar 7.56; 2 Maroussia Pare 7.56; 3
Helene Parisot 7.67; 4 Olivia Mazeau 7.67; 400m Fanny Lefevre 55.79; 60mh 1 Mathilde Raibaut 8.43; 2
Sandra Sogoyou 8.45; 3 Merryl Mbeng 8.70; LJ Haoua Kessely 6.32; TJ 1 Jeanine Assani Issouf 13.71; 2
Haoua Kessely 13.36
Lille (France), 4.1.2014 (indoor)
Men
HJ Sebastien Deschamps 2.18
Lyon (France), 4.2.2105 (indoor)
Women
60mh 1 Mathilde Raibaut 8.66; 2 Rougui Sow 8.70 (8.66 1h1); in heats: Clemence Vifquin 8.68 1h2
Nice (France), 4.1.2015 (indoor)
Men 50mh u18 (0,91m) Yvan Lopes Ribeiro (por) 6.97
Women
50m Eleonora Cadetto (ita) 6.75; 50mh 1 Chloe Maurin 7.52; 2 Laurien Hoos (ned) 7.73 (7.65 1h1); 3
Yasmina Agbi 7.74; 50mh u18 (0.76m) Nina Brino Forgnon 7.63; in heats: Emma Montoya 7.71 2h
